Re: Unable to activate eSim

What i did was to open the mysky app, tap mobile at the botton.

 

Then tap your Sim under the heading of 'You sims' (scroll down a little, i have 6 sims so just found my one in the row)

Tap manage sim

tap 'sim options'

sroll down and tap - replace my eSim

folliow the guide.  you will get a few emails from sky.  Wait until you get the last one which will have a 4 digit PIN code on it, you will need that.  Once you have that code, look for the email that has the link for the esim on it and tap 'install esim'.  it will take you to a new screen on your phone where it will ask you for the 4 digit PIN code, type this in and it should the activate.

 

Hope this helps
